Detroit — Detroit police are investigating a nonfatal shooting on the city's east side. 

Police responded Friday at 11:16 p.m. to 7 Mile and Van Dyke, where they found a 30-year-old male with a gunshot wound.

Police said the victim was picked up at the Coney Island and was privately taken to the hospital. He is in temporary serious condition.
